Been playing the CBT for a bit now and wanted to share since I know there's mixed feelings here about the CN client in general.

Honestly the game itself feels really good right now. Early zones and pacing feel closer to that original 1.0 era ArcheAge experience rather than the later power creep endgame stuff. If you played back in the day and missed that feeling, it scratches the itch.

The open world PvP has honestly been kind of insane so far. Got caught up in a huge fight out at Halcyona, felt like 200v200 at one point, and performance held up way better than I expected. I'm playing on ~190ms and didn't run into any noticeable lag during it, which genuinely surprised me given the scale.

Pirating also been really fun. Managed to steal a couple fishing boats and a few trade packs already. Feels like that early AA chaos where you genuinely have to watch your back out on the water.

Was very excited by my first "decent" item in form of epic obsidian greatsword.

After 3 days of gathering mats I've finally made it to t5... just to stare at it in disbelief for few seconds, cause the stats of epic t5 obsidian are the same as my hasla emerald greatsword, rotfl, as such I flushed a week or two worth of income making it just to get a 16.5% more critical damage and 40 gear score points.

I literally thought that t5 epic will SURELY outclass a divine weapon but I was very wrong, feeling a bit cheated to be honest. Sure, I guess I can upgrade it to t6 after another month, but now I dread to think if my obsidian armor will suck too compared to the celestial welfare gear.

What now? I clearly can't trust myself with making decisions, what piece(s) to gather resources for?

News ArcheAge is Officially Getting a PC Reboot! XLGAMES Partners with Chinese Dev for "ArcheAge: Returns" — Pioneer CN CBT Starts June 26th

129 Upvotes

Hi everyone,

Huge news for anyone who misses the glory days of ArcheAge. It looks like the original game is officially being rebooted! A Chinese developer/publisher (Chuangtian Mutual Entertainment) has entered into a joint licensing agreement with XLGAMES to bring back the classic PC experience under the title "ArcheAge: Return" (上古世纪归来).

They just announced their Pioneer Closed Beta Test (CBT), which is set to begin on June 26, 2026. This initial test will be a data-wipe CBT on PC with no cash shop/microtransactions, mainly focusing on server stability and optimization.

According to the official announcement, this isn't just a lazy "Classic" cash-grab server—they are actively aiming to fix the core issues that plagued the original game. Here are the key takeaways:

🗺️ World & Visuals

  • 1:1 Classic Map Replica: A seamless, no-loading-screen open world featuring iconic zones like Halcyona, White Arden, Songcraft, and Ynystere.
  • HD Remaster: The terrain and resource spots remain exactly the same as the classic version, but the graphics, lighting, and model precision are getting a major HD upgrade.
  • Gliders, climbing, and deep-sea exploration are all fully intact.

⚔️ Classes & Combat

  • 100% Faithful Mechanics: All 14 original skillsets (Battlerage, Witchcraft, Defense, Auramancy, Occultism, etc.) are returning, allowing for the classic 100+ class combinations (Blighter, Primeval, etc.).
  • No Random Balance Changes: The devs explicitly promised that all skill effects, numerical scaling, and gear adaptation rules will strictly match the classic version.

⛵ Massive RvR & Naval Fixes

  • Fixing the Lag: The main focus of this test is optimizing server loads for 1,000+ players on screen. They specifically highlighted fixing the notorious "lag spikes during massive faction wars" issue.
  • Full Sea Content: Naval warfare (clippers, galleons), sea trade runs, Leviathan raids, and Halcyona faction wars with siege engines are all fully operational.

🏡 Economy & Anti-Cheat

  • All 16 crafting/gathering professions, housing plots, and free trading channels (Auction House, player-to-player trading, open stalls) are back.
  • Anti-Bot Monitoring: To prevent the land monopoly and economy ruins caused by studio bots in the past, the publishers are implementing a real-time monitoring system during the test to build a robust anti-cheat framework.

The development team stated they are working under a long-term "expansion/patch" model and promised that any future new content "will absolutely not destroy the original core ecosystem" of the game.

Obviously, this is currently a China-focused release managed by a local publisher alongside XLGAMES, so we'll have to see if a global version ever becomes a reality.
